/**
|
|
* Issue #2986 — Payload Rules not persisting across server restart.
|
|
*
|
|
* Rules are written to the DB (key_value `settings.payloadRules`) and mirrored
|
|
* into an in-memory `runtimeOverride`. After a restart, if `runtimeOverride` is
|
|
* null (the boot hook didn't run in this module instance, or a separate bundle
|
|
* instance), `getPayloadRulesConfig` used to fall back to the (usually empty)
|
|
* file config and return no rules.
|
|
*
|
|
* Fix: when there is no in-memory override, read the DB-persisted rules — the
|
|
* source of truth — before the file. This test simulates a restart by clearing
|
|
* the in-memory override and asserting the persisted rules still come back.
|
|
*/
